The Role of AI in Modern Business

AI agents are sophisticated software entities designed to perceive their environment, make decisions, and take actions to achieve specific goals. These agents are powered by technologies such as large language models and prediction algorithms, enabling them to process vast amounts of data and generate insights with remarkable speed and accuracy.

A recent Gartner report predicts that by 2025, 80% of customer service interactions will involve some form of AI, including AI agents

AI’s impact on businesses is multifaceted:

  • Enhanced Decision Making: AI analyzes complex data sets to provide insights that inform strategic decisions.
  • Improved Efficiency: Automation of routine tasks allows employees to focus on high-value activities.
  • Personalized Customer Experiences: AI-driven analytics enable businesses to tailor offerings to individual customer preferences.
  • Predictive Capabilities: AI models can forecast trends, helping businesses prepare for future market conditions.

Overcoming the Challenges of AI Implementation

Overcoming the Challenges of AI Implementation

Implementing AI agents, while offering immense potential, presents a unique set of challenges. These challenges, if not addressed strategically, can hinder successful adoption and limit the return on investment. Here’s a breakdown of these key hurdles and corresponding solutions:

1. Scaling for Success

  • Economies of Scale: Achieving cost-effectiveness with AI often requires significant scale. Solution: Develop a phased approach, starting with targeted applications and expanding strategically as ROI is demonstrated. Leverage cloud infrastructure for flexible scaling.
  • Hardware Availability and Cost: AI/ML workloads can demand substantial computing resources. Solution: Utilize cloud-based solutions like Google Cloud, offering access to high-performance computing on demand, optimizing costs and eliminating the need for large upfront hardware investments.
  • Latency Reduction vs. Cost Alignment: Balancing the need for low latency (especially in real-time applications) with cost considerations is crucial.Solution: Optimize AI model design and deployment strategies. Explore edge computing for latency-sensitive applications while leveraging cloud resources for large-scale processing.
  • Scaling to Capture All End-Users: Ensuring the AI solution can handle the volume and diversity of user interactions is essential.Solution: Design scalable architectures, leveraging cloud platforms and containerization technologies to accommodate growth and fluctuating demand.

2. Production Readiness and Ongoing Maintenance

  • Level of Effort to Production (PoC to MVP to Pilot): Moving from a proof-of-concept to a production-ready application requires significant effort. Solution: Establish clear development processes, utilize agile methodologies, and leverage pre-built components and accelerators where possible.
  • Infrastructure Implementation and Recurring Costs: Setting up and maintaining the necessary infrastructure can be complex and expensive. Solution: Utilise cloud platforms to reduce infrastructure complexity and optimize costs. Make use of managed services to minimize operational overhead.
  • Model Governance and Maintenance Automation: AI/ML models need continuous monitoring, updating, and governance. Solution: Implement automated model management tools and establish clear governance frameworks to ensure model performance, compliance, and ethical considerations.
  • Explainability and Model Auditing: Understanding how AI models make decisions is crucial for building trust and ensuring accountability. Solution: Implement explainable AI (XAI) techniques and model auditing tools to provide insights into model behavior and identify potential biases.
  • Longevity and Maintenance of the Application: AI applications require ongoing maintenance and adaptation to remain effective. Solution: Establish a dedicated maintenance and support team, implement continuous integration and continuous delivery (CI/CD) pipelines, and plan for regular model retraining and updates.

The Human Element: Skills, Trust, and Change Management

  • Closing the Skill Gap: A shortage of AI/ML expertise is a major challenge. Solution: Invest in training and development programs to upskill existing employees. Partner with experts to supplement internal capabilities.
  • Complexity of Systems and Lack of Internal Expertise: AI/ML systems can be complex, and many organizations lack the internal expertise to build and maintain them. Solution: Partner with experienced AI consulting firms like 66degrees to guide implementation and provide ongoing support.
  • Continued Learning, Support, and Enablement: AI is a rapidly evolving field. Solution: Foster a culture of continuous learning and provide ongoing support and enablement to ensure teams stay up-to-date with the latest advancements.
  • Displaying and Communicating Return on Investment: Demonstrating the value of AI investments is crucial for securing buy-in. Solution: Define clear KPIs and track progress. Communicate ROI transparently to stakeholders.
  • Change Management: Introducing AI can significantly impact workflows and roles. Solution: Develop a comprehensive change management plan to address employee concerns, provide training, and ensure smooth adoption.
